html {
  padding: 0; margin: 0;
  min-height: 100%;
  border-left: 40px solid #336600;
}

body {
  margin: 1em 3em;
  font-family:  Verdana, Arial;
  font-size: 0.8em;
  
}

#header {
  padding: 0px;
  padding-top:0px;
  margin-left: 0em;
  padding-left: 0em;
  font-family:  Verdana, Arial;
  font-size: 220%;
  font-weight: bold;
  width:990px;
  /*border-bottom: 4px solid #ffff00; */
}

#header img {
  vertical-align: baseline;
}

#menu {
  max-width: 15em;
  float: right;
  padding: 1em;
}

#content {
  max-width: 640px;
}

li p { margin: 0; }

h1, h2 { color: #336600; }

h1 { font-size: 160%; }
h2 { font-size: 130%; }

a:link, a:visited { color: #cc3333; }

.leftimg {
  float: left;
  padding: 10px;
}

.rightimg {
  float: right;
  padding: 10px;
}

.img {
  padding: 10px;
}

